1997 Diamante Overview
Among the 225 owners who provided feedback on the 1997 Mitsubishi Diamante for Kelley Blue Book, consumer sentiment is overwhelmingly positive, with 95% recommending the vehicle. As a whole, consumers found the vehicle's comfort and performance to be its strongest features and value to be its weakest. 165 out of 225 of owners (73% of them) rank the 1997 Diamante five out of five stars. "I love this car!!!"

I have driven many cars with being a mechanic. The Diamante LS is by far the most enjoyable car I have driven and owned!! The "put you in your seat power" and take off is none comparable to others in it's class. The handling is that of a BMW or Mercedes. The controls layout is user friendly minus the "clock controls". However, parts are hard to find and most are only "dealer available". Servicing the car is also saved for the mechanic shop.

This is my 3rd Diamante and my last. Why? Well They don't make them any more. If they did I would buy another when this wears out. But at 99K miles it has many years left. These have a good V6 and if you don't do your own maintenance it can be expensive. For instance to change the back plugs you need to partially remove the intake manifold. But the plugs last 50K miles. I can do it in 1/2 hour. Only other problem is the water leak which is fixed for 3 hours work and a $1.25 O ring. Once fixed there are no other problems with this car. They drive nice, Plenty of power. Quiet and has features found only in the posh luxury autos and then only at extra cost. duel power seats, ski slots, great radio, heated seats, sensing intermittent wipers, etc. I own two and probably won't sell either because they are hard to find. I'd rather drive this than a 750 or 525. Seems built better than both.
